In the rapidly evolving world of broadcasting, playout software has emerged as a game-changer, transforming the way television channels and radio stations manage their content and deliver it to their audiences. Playout software, also known as automation software, is a critical component of modern broadcasting, enabling seamless and efficient playback of video and audio content. With the proliferation of video-on-demand services, broadcasters and content producers are under pressure to make their services more agile and cost-effective. Full-scale adoption of IP and cloud solutions is already underway, with broadcasters employing integrated playout automation solutions and channel-in-a-box technologies, enabling swift and seamless launch of new channels. playout software
